CJC-1295 without DAC — often searched as Modified GRF 1-29 — is a cornerstone of growth-hormone research and one of the most studied GH-pulse peptides in the literature. It is a growth-hormone-releasing-hormone (GHRH) analogue that prompts the pituitary to release GH in the short, natural pulses the body normally uses. Dropping the Drug Affinity Complex (DAC) gives it a shorter half-life, which researchers study specifically for tighter, more physiological pulse patterns.

It is most often studied side by side with Ipamorelin, since the two reach growth-hormone release through complementary pathways.

How should CJC-1295 (No DAC) be stored?+
Sealed lyophilised CJC-1295 (No DAC) is stored at -20 °C. Once reconstituted, refrigerate at 2–8 °C. Commonly worked with for 2-3 weeks at 2-8 °C. Avoid repeated freeze–thaw cycles.
